Bug#380211: kmix: wish to be able to attach documentation to controls



Package: kmix
Version: 4:3.5.3-2
Severity: wishlist


With my SoundBlaster Live! 5.1 digital model SB0220 EMU10K1 sound card, 
it is difficult to remember the significance of all all the controls and 
it would also be good to be able to attach notes to the controls 
documenting their significance and appropriate settings.

On a more general note, a sound card calibration test suite would be 
good for determining appropriate settings to avoid distortion and 
unintended feedback.

A possible starting point may be the tool available from:

http://www.theory.physics.ubc.ca/soundcard/soundcard.html
